Transaction 75ddc0c35a21d90616d7ec037ba3a57ca6f843be62136dea580bb2f8d2b4c5ba
1 Input
1 Output
-
75ddc0c35a21d90616d7ec037ba3a57ca6f843be62136dea580bb2f8d2b4c5ba:0
- value
- 1792315
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d412da818cf60729f943ff45dd5a417071e07a3b OP_EQUAL
- address
- 3M2MmBKKoWTzwZSFMgTRPbEQN2sgxupV3c